Account recovery, consent-banner edition. If you get locked out of the Mossbridge rollout console mid-deploy (happens more than you'd think — the session store resets when the banner config flips regions), don't panic and don't re-trigger the rollout. Pause the flag in Fernwick first, then recover your account through the break-glass flow. It'll ask for the team recovery phrase before letting you back in. Type the passphrase below exactly as written.

unlock words, taguf-yafop: quenwyn-druox

## Configuration

Echohall serves audio-guide tracks for the Larkmoor Gallery app. Most knobs live in `config.yaml`, but runtime stuff goes in `.env`: `STREAM_BITRATE` (default 96), `EXHIBIT_CACHE_TTL`, and `LANG_FALLBACK=en`. If tracks stop playing mid-tour, check the CDN origin first — nine times out of ten it's an expired credential. The origin token itself lives in the env file on the line below.

secret setting of yajog-taguf: ARCHIVE_KEY3=051

Hey Dominic — quick handover on the quiet room up on 7 at Thornvale Place. Booking sheet lives on the door; assistants can pencil people in for max two hours. Blinds are temperamental — jiggle the left cord. The kettle stays, the heater goes back to storage Friday. Cleaning crew skips the room on Tuesdays, so do a quick tidy then. The door reader was reprogrammed last week, so the old code is dead — use this one.

door code, yagap-bahof: bdg-O-05